As far as the team, on paper yes I agree they should have a shot at the Presidents Trophy and playoff success, however a lot has to go right.

Jack Hughes is still small and somewhat injury prone. He needed to add 5-10 pounds and some muscle but I'm not sure he was able to since he was recovering from surgery. Luke Hughes needs to get healthy. Bratt and Hischier need to keep improving and not take steps back. Second half Timo needs to be full season Timo. Markstrom and Allen have to stay on top of their game and HEALTHY because the moment goalies start going down this team will crumble.

I'm very excited about this team... but I remember last year a lot of people picked the Devils as division winners, conference winners, even cup winners in some cases and we all know how that went. Everything that could go wrong, went wrong.

Yes Tom Fitzgerald did an amazing job addressing every need this team had...

All we can say at this point is "WE SHALL SEE"
